What is a Blockchain Explorer Briefly?
A blockchain explorer is a website that lets you visualize blocks, transaction histories, and various blockchain metrics. Every blockchain network has its own dedicated explorer, providing data exclusively for that network. For instance, Solana and Tron each have their own separate explorers. Each explorer operates independently, tailored to the specifics of its respective cryptocurrency.
How does a Blockchain Explorer Work?
A blockchain explorer connects to the nodes of a blockchain network and retrieves data about transactions, blocks, addresses, and other relevant information. When a user requests details, such as a specific transaction or wallet, the explorer queries the blockchain to fetch the necessary data, including block hashes, transaction confirmations, sender and recipient addresses, and fees.
The core functionality of a blockchain explorer is that all transactions are recorded in blocks, which are subsequently added to the chain. The explorer scans this chain, indexing and organizing the data for easy viewing. Each block has a unique identifier (hash), which allows for precise tracking of network activity at any given moment.
When a user accesses a blockchain explorer, they can obtain:
- Information about current and past transactions
- Wallet balances
- Transaction history for a specific address
- Block statistics, including block numbers, sizes, transaction counts, and timestamps
The explorer presents this data in a user-friendly format, enabling individuals to easily track transaction status or gather information about blocks and addresses within the network.
Basic Functions of a Blockchain Explorer
Let’s divide the functions of a blockchain explorer into those for regular users and those for advanced users. This will help clearly explain how each type of user can use the tool for their own purposes.
For Regular Users
Let’s take a look at the main functions of a blockchain explorer that crypto enthusiasts use:
1. Searching for transactions by TX ID: A blockchain explorer allows you to find any transaction by its unique identifier (TX ID). This helps you check the transaction’s status (whether it has been confirmed), the transfer time, and the transaction fee.

2. Viewing your wallet balance: To find out how much cryptocurrency is in your wallet, simply enter its address in the blockchain explorer. You’ll see your current balance along with a list of all transactions associated with this wallet.

3. Checking the transfer status: You can track whether your funds have reached the recipient or when they will be confirmed on the network. The bitcoin explorer will display:
- Transaction status: pending confirmation or completed
- The number of confirmations that confirm the success of the transaction
4. Viewing block information: Each block contains multiple transactions. The bitcoin block explorer allows you to find out which blocks have been added to the blockchain. You can view information about the current block, such as its hash, creation time, and other parameters.
For Advanced Users
For advanced users, a blockchain explorer provides access to sophisticated analysis features, enabling a more precise tracking of blockchain activity:
- Analysis of smart contracts and tokens: Explorers allow users to examine the activity of smart contracts linked to decentralized applications or tokens. You can monitor contract changes, execution details, and transactions related to various tokens on the platform.
- Analysis of criminal activity: Explorers can be used for investigative purposes, identifying suspicious transactions, tracing funds between flagged addresses, or analyzing potential money laundering by checking connections between addresses and sources of funds.
- Tracking large wallets and funds: Advanced users use explorers to monitor significant wallets and fund movements. This helps track large transfers and the investment strategies of major players or exchanges, offering valuable insights into market trends.
- Checking addresses and interactions between them: Blockchain explorers allow for the investigation of how different addresses interact with one another. This is useful for analyzing transaction networks to uncover connections between wallets, such as understanding investment flows or identifying suspicious activities.
- Analyzing networks and connections between addresses: Advanced users can leverage explorers to analyze networks of interconnected addresses. This includes examining large fund flows and identifying transactions that may indicate specific market trends or fraudulent schemes.
- Checking block statistics and detailed data: For deeper analysis, explorers provide detailed information about each block, such as its hash, creation time, and the number of transactions. This enables tracking activity at the block level and evaluating network performance.
- Integration with analytical platforms: Some blockchain explorers integrate with external analytics platforms, providing users with additional tools to predict price movements, analyze liquidity, and monitor cryptocurrency market activity.
Popular Blockchain Explorers
Let’s take a look at some of the most popular blockchain explorers:
- Etherscan: Etherscan is one of the most widely used explorers for the Ethereum network. It provides detailed information about transactions, addresses, smart contracts, and tokens on the Ethereum blockchain. Users can search for any address, transaction, or block and access statistics on various tokens, such as ERC-20 and NFT ERC-721. Etherscan also allows you to check smart contracts and their source code, monitor tokens, set up notifications for new transactions and blocks, and analyze interactions with decentralized applications (DeFi). Features include checking major exchanges’ addresses, analyzing blocks and mining activity, using an API for data integration, and directly interacting with contracts via “Write” and “Read Contract.”

- Blockchain.com — is a well-known explorer for the Bitcoin network. Blockchain explorer bitcoin allows users to track transactions and blocks, while also providing valuable statistics about the Bitcoin network, including current hash rates and block confirmations.

- Blockchair — is a multi-blockchain explorer that supports 48 different blockchain networks. It allows for searches by transaction, address, and block, and also provides comprehensive network analytics.

- Solscan — is a blockchain explorer for the Solana network. It allows users to track transactions, addresses, and blocks on Solana, providing a user-friendly interface for interacting with the high-speed, low-cost Solana network.

- Tronscan — is the explorer for the Tron network. It offers insights into transactions, addresses, smart contracts, and tokens on the Tron blockchain, and also supports tracking activity within decentralized applications (dapps) on the platform.

- Tonscan — is the blockchain explorer for the TON (The Open Network) blockchain, initially developed by the team behind Telegram. The explorer offers tools for monitoring and analyzing all operations on the TON network, which is designed for high-speed transactions and decentralized applications (dapps).

Pros and Cons
Advantages of Using Blockchain Explorers:
- Transparency: Blockchain explorers offer full access to transaction, block, and address data, enabling users to track and verify cryptocurrency information in real time.
- Accessibility: These tools are free and available to all users, regardless of their level of expertise. Blockchain explorers simplify the process of understanding how cryptocurrency networks function.
- Security: Explorers help users track transaction statuses, confirmations, and fees, which are crucial for ensuring secure and successful transfers.
- Analytics and Research: Blockchain explorers provide powerful tools for deeper analysis, such as monitoring block activity, researching smart contracts and tokens, and studying the behavior of large wallets and markets.
- Data Verification: Explorers are essential for forensic analysis, helping users trace fund flows, identify fraudulent activities, and check transactions involving suspicious addresses.
However, blockchain explorers also have their drawbacks:
- Limited transaction information: Some explorers fail to display all transaction or block details, such as smart contract information or complex operations, making it harder for experienced users to conduct in-depth analysis.
- Delay in data updates: During periods of high network activity, data on explorers may not update in real time. This delay can result in outdated information, which is critical when monitoring urgent operations.
- Complex interfaces for beginners: For those new to cryptocurrencies, the interfaces of some explorers can be overwhelming. It’s not always obvious what data to search for or how to interpret it.
- Limited blockchain support: Most explorers are designed to support only one network or a small number of blockchains, which can be limiting for users working with multiple cryptocurrencies or lesser-known blockchains.
The Future of Blockchain Explorers
As technology evolves, blockchain explorers are set to become more integrated with analytics platforms, supporting multiple blockchain networks to enhance user convenience. This will allow users to analyze data from various platforms within a single interface, as well as access more detailed information about transactions, smart contracts, and activity within DeFi, NFTs, and other decentralized applications.
Additionally, user interfaces are expected to improve, making explorers more accessible for beginners. Features like automatic notifications and simplified navigation will make it easier for users to track important events. The incorporation of artificial intelligence and machine learning will enable more effective data analysis, helping to identify anomalies and enhance network security.
